iubenda™ | Visit Official Site | Start with the Free Plan
https://www.iubenda.com › self-updating › legal-solutions
AdProfessional compliance solution rated 4.5 on Trustpilot. Are you considering iubenda to comply? Great choice! 130,000 customers already trust us
Español · Documentation · English · Italiano